Bash的命令替换

 命令替换:将命令替换为命令的输出,所有的shell支持使用反引号的方法进行命令替换。
Bash支持两种形式:$(command)`command`
命令替换是可以嵌套的,如果使用反引号的形式,在内部反引用前必须使用反斜线转义。

例子:
$echo $(pwd)

$echo `pwd`

命令替换嵌套
$echo `basename \`pwd\``

$echo $(basename $(pwd)) //嵌套更方便 

=-=-=-=-=
Powered by Blogilo

posted on 2015-08-08 23:46  chenxiaopang  阅读(644)  评论(0编辑  收藏  举报

导航